Overview

Stardust seeks an engineering leader to oversee the team of blockchain engineers to integrate the Stardust API with our currently supported and future blockchains.

Duties

As the Head of Blockchain Engineering at Stardust you’ll be helping both junior and senior engineers as we build out our team
Everyone is an IC at Stardust, from managers to engineers and as part of this job you’ll also be reviewing code, and writing code in a specific instance
You will work with engineering teams to set service-level objectives, improve observability, ensure production readiness, optimize service and system performance and facilitate incident response and follow up
Improve observability, reliability and availability by defining and measuring key metrics
Partner with Engineering teams to teach and demonstrate industry best practices
Facilitate incident response, conduct root cause analysis and blameless retrospectives
Automate operational tasks such as load testing
Help partners design and implement reliable system architectures
